@Pete,

I liked your work.  Lots of excellent animation and expertly done camera work.

I really appreciate your landscapes, and have to learn more about that myself.  (I really should do a better job of bookmarking some of these tutorials that appear from time-to-time.)

I'm going to agree with Gizmo about the pacing.  There are numerous places where there is 1 or 2 seconds between dialogue that makes for awkward pauses.  Sometimes it might be more noticeable because it's hard to show subtle emotions in iClone.  But in my case it's simply that I find it easier to assemble a scene with extra "white space" and a minimum of overlap between events.  This is something I struggle with myself, especially in my initial versions of a scene.

I some cases it's easily fixed but cutting out a second or two in your video editor, but if the camera stays on a character, and that character has an idle motion, or trees are waving in the background, you end up with "jumps" in the video.

Then you really only have two solutions

  • Slide all the keyframes to the left, an that can get tricky if you have a lot of characters and camera cuts and props that move.  It's easy to overlook something.
  • "Delete frames" is the best solution, but that takes a long time, so if you have to do a lot of little improvements, it gets very arduous and time-consuming (which is why I wrote it up in the "Enhancements" section of the forum).

I sometimes use a combination of both.  Slide some keyframes around so I have fewer, but larger gaps, and then use the "delete frames" option.

(Note:  Just because I'm aware of this issue and am sensitive to it, does not necessarily mean my clips are shining examples of how to do it right.  It just means I'm very aware of it, even in my own clips.)

Sorry to ramble on so long.  I liked the video work.  Nice audio work (sound effects, ambient sound, and background music).  Interesting story.  I think if you "tighten it up" that would be the biggest single thing that would help keep the audience engaged in your excellent video.
